Inventory management functionality includes warehouse transfers tracking stock movement between two warehouses using transfer cards that show stages: initial warehouse, transit, and destination warehouse. The Move/Merge feature in SkuVault Core allows seamless inventory transfer between warehouses and locations. The platform uses an inventory sync system to keep stock updated across all sales channels, with quantity buffers preventing overselling by adjusting displayed available quantity for specific marketplaces.
Order management capabilities enable users to right-click on items in My Inventory to order to Minimum Level threshold or Smart Calculate (averages last 3 purchase orders). The system provides an Open Order screen showing if items meet order requirements, allowing users to create Purchase Orders from this screen. Reorder Low Stock functionality enables ordering to Minimum Level, while Stock Forecasting uses data for reorder planning.
The platform automatically updates inventory when orders are received and processed, sending new stock amounts to all sales channels. It supports multiple marketplaces (Amazon, eBay, website) sharing quantities, with quantity buffers preventing overselling by directing last available quantity to specific marketplaces. Linnworks' Warehouse Management Systems (WMS) represents a significant advance in physical operations, building on the foundational capabilities of their core platform. As a recognized leader in the industry, the WMS suite offers several key benefits that address the complexities of modern warehousing.
The system's work efficiency features streamline daily operations, allowing fulfillment teams to accomplish more with less manual labor. Digital picklists, for instance, optimize order fulfillment routes, while barcode scans and stock counts provide real-time visibility into product location across the warehouse. This level of transparency ensures that every item moves from shelf to shipping with confidence.
In terms of inventory management, the WMS system removes common restrictions found in traditional systems, allowing retailers to store similar SKUs across multiple bin racks rather than being limited to one SKU per bin rack. This flexibility optimizes space utilization and simplifies inventory organization, particularly for retailers managing complex product lines.
From an operational perspective, the system enables retailers to map every zone, group, and bin type, providing better delegation and demand adaptation. The digital picklists feature stands out for its ability to show the most efficient route for order fulfillment, while automated picklists improve both staff and customer satisfaction by streamlining the picking process.
The WMS system is available as an add-on to Linnworks Advanced, allowing retailers to customize stock availability and define picking routes through WMS locations. Perhaps most compellingly, it offers functionality called Default Stock Availability for outbound connections, providing retailers with the tools to manage their physical operations as efficiently as their digital channels.

The platform's pricing structure is tiered based on monthly orders processed, with additional modules available for advanced functionality such as WMS and forecasting services. The company provides multiple plans including SkuVault Core and Linnworks Advanced, with the latter offering a comprehensive suite of features for complex ecommerce operations.
The SkuVault Core package is designed for retailers transitioning from spreadsheets to streamline warehouse operations quickly, while the Linnworks Advanced package provides a centralized platform for ecommerce management from listing through shipping and fulfillment, with automated order management capabilities. The Advanced package includes multiple add-ons to build full functionality, including the Listing module for creating and updating listings across key channels, the Warehouse Management System for configuring and automating physical warehouse operations, and the Forecasting module for smarter ordering and replenishment through pre-configured settings.
